Work out physiology is often a branch of science that concentrates on how your body responds and adapts to Actual physical action. It consists of the examine of various physiological mechanisms that manifest in your body during work out, which include People relevant to the cardiovascular procedure, muscular technique, respiratory method, and metabolic processes. Understanding the principles of exercise physiology allows for better insight into how workout is usually optimized for health, Conditioning, performance, and rehabilitation.

When anyone engages in Bodily action, various physiological alterations take place inside the body. The center charge will increase, blood vessels dilate to allow much more oxygen-prosperous blood to get to the muscles, and the respiratory method will work more difficult to usher in additional oxygen and remove carbon dioxide. Workout also spots anxiety on muscles, bones, and joints, which ends up in adaptations that fortify these structures after some time. Together with these quick variations, regular work out will cause prolonged-phrase adaptations that make improvements to General Conditioning and wellness.

The research of exercising physiology also appears at how differing kinds of exercise impact the body. Aerobic workout, By way of example, involves sustained, rhythmic activity that increases the efficiency in the cardiovascular and respiratory units. Things to do like working, swimming, or biking are key examples of aerobic exercising, in which the human body depends totally on oxygen to make energy. With time, aerobic exercising can cause enhanced coronary heart operate, greater lung potential, and enhanced endurance.

Then again, anaerobic physical exercise consists of brief bursts of significant-intensity activity that rely on Electrical power sources saved throughout the muscles, as opposed to oxygen. Activities for instance weightlifting, sprinting, or superior-intensity interval coaching (HIIT) entail anaerobic processes. These exercise routines are significantly efficient at constructing muscle mass strength and ability, along with improving anaerobic endurance. Being familiar with the physiological dissimilarities involving aerobic and anaerobic exercising helps folks and athletes tailor their teaching to meet distinct fitness or overall performance targets.

The purpose on the muscular technique is very important in exercise physiology. Muscles are composed of fibers that deal to produce motion. When muscles are subjected to your stress of training, notably resistance teaching, they undertake microscopic hurt. In response, the body repairs and rebuilds these muscle fibers, making them more powerful and even more resilient after a while. This process is called muscle hypertrophy. In contrast, endurance education which include extended-distance jogging primarily boosts the muscles' ability to sustain extended exercise by increasing the efficiency of Vitality output and utilization. Both energy and endurance adaptations are essential for All round physical overall performance.

Another key ingredient of training physiology is metabolism, the method by which the body converts food stuff into Electricity. Through exercising, the human body calls for much more energy, and it faucets into its Vitality suppliers to fuel muscle contractions. Carbohydrates and fats are the principal Vitality sources for the duration of exercise, and the body switches among these dependant upon the intensity and duration from the exercise. At lower intensities, for example for the duration of a leisurely wander, your body primarily burns Extra fat for gas. On the other hand, as intensity raises, including in the course of a sprint, carbohydrates turn out to be the popular Vitality source. This is because carbohydrates can be broken down more quickly to satisfy the large Strength demands of intense work out.

On the list of long-expression benefits of standard exercising is enhanced metabolic effectiveness. As an example, those who have interaction in frequent aerobic work out often burn up Extra fat much more efficiently, even at rest. This is certainly due in part to a rise in mitochondrial density inside of muscle cells. Mitochondria are generally known as the powerhouses in the mobile given that they are accountable for manufacturing Electricity. Additional mitochondria mean the muscles can deliver much more Electrical power applying oxygen, enabling for much better endurance and efficiency through extended physical exercise.

Workout also has a significant influence on the cardiovascular technique. Common physical action strengthens the heart, which is a muscle, letting it to pump blood extra successfully all through the overall body. This enhances circulation and makes certain that oxygen and nutrients are delivered to tissues a lot more successfully. Exercise also lowers hypertension by cutting down the resistance in blood vessels, which often can lower the risk of cardiovascular disease. Moreover, exercising improves levels of substantial-density lipoprotein (HDL), usually generally known as "great" cholesterol, when lowering levels of lower-density lipoprotein (LDL), or "terrible" cholesterol. This increases General cardiovascular health and fitness and reduces the chance of atherosclerosis, a affliction characterised from the buildup of fatty deposits in arteries.

The respiratory technique is Similarly influenced by exercise. When the body engages in physical activity, the demand for oxygen raises. To satisfy this need, the respiratory charge rises, plus the lungs acquire in more oxygen even though expelling carbon dioxide at a speedier level. Eventually, common exercising strengthens the respiratory muscles, including the diaphragm, making it possible for the lungs to increase much more fully and increasing lung potential. This ends in enhanced oxygen uptake and even more productive fuel Trade, which is particularly valuable for endurance athletes who need sustained Vitality production around extensive intervals.

Hormonal responses may also be a major element of work out physiology. Training stimulates the release of various hormones, such as adrenaline, cortisol, and progress hormone. Adrenaline prepares your body for Actual physical exertion by escalating coronary heart price, blood circulation to muscles, and Power availability. Cortisol, usually referred to as the strain hormone, is introduced in reaction to exercise to aid regulate metabolism and Management inflammation. Growth hormone, that's produced throughout the two aerobic and anaerobic work out, performs a vital purpose in muscle mass restore and development, in addition to Unwanted fat metabolism. These hormonal alterations don't just add to instant effectiveness but will also boost Restoration and adaptation after a while.

Along with the Actual physical variations that come about all through exercising, there are also considerable psychological Added benefits. Training continues to be shown to cut back indications of panic and melancholy, improve mood, and Increase In general psychological wellness. This can be partly due to the release of endorphins, which might be chemicals while in the Mind that act as natural painkillers and mood enhancers. Typical Actual physical action also can help make improvements to slumber quality, which can be essential for Restoration and In general effectively-staying.

Restoration is an additional vital aspect of training physiology. Following Actual physical exertion, your body demands time and energy to repair service and rebuild. This method will involve the removing of squander products and solutions like lactic acid, the replenishment of Electrical power merchants, as well as repair service of ruined tissues. Suitable relaxation, hydration, and diet are vital elements of recovery. The kind and intensity of work out figure out the duration and mother nature from the Restoration system. For illustration, higher-intensity activities like weightlifting or sprinting demand for a longer time Restoration periods as a consequence of the significant strain they area on muscles, whilst lower-depth functions including strolling or cycling may perhaps involve much less recovery time.

On top of that, physical exercise physiology delves into how unique populations reply to Actual physical activity. One example is, age plays an important https://www.bodybuilding.com/author/jim-stoppani-phd position in how the body adapts to training. As men and women age, You will find a pure decrease in muscle mass, bone density, and cardiovascular functionality. However, regular Bodily activity can slow or simply reverse Some age-similar variations. Toughness teaching is particularly helpful for more mature Grownups, as it can help retain muscle mass and bone density, minimizing the chance of falls and fractures. Similarly, aerobic exercise can make improvements to heart well being and cognitive operate in older individuals.

Gender also influences the physiological responses to exercising. Investigate has shown that men and women may perhaps respond in a different way to varied varieties of work out due to hormonal distinctions, specifically in relation to testosterone and estrogen. By way of example, Guys commonly Have a very larger ability for constructing muscle mass as a result of greater levels of testosterone, whilst women might have a bonus in endurance functions as a consequence of dissimilarities in Extra fat metabolism. Nevertheless, equally Males and girls can take advantage of a mix of toughness and endurance coaching to boost Over-all Conditioning and health and fitness.

Another location of interest in exercising physiology would be the principle of overtraining, which occurs when somebody engages in too much Actual physical action without enough relaxation. Overtraining may result in a drop in general performance, amplified threat of injuries, and Persistent tiredness. It is important for people and athletes to strike a harmony amongst teaching and Restoration to avoid the detrimental results of overtraining. Checking crucial indicators like coronary heart level, sleep high quality, and Vitality stages can assist identify early signs of overtraining, enabling for changes during the instruction routine to market Restoration.

Last but not least, the applying of exercise physiology extends to rehabilitation and injuries prevention. Understanding the body's physiological responses to exercising is crucial for coming up with effective rehabilitation applications for people recovering from accidents or surgical procedures. Exercise performs an important role in restoring function, improving upon mobility, and protecting against long run injuries. One example is, unique exercise routines may be prescribed to fortify weak muscles, increase joint stability, and greatly enhance overall flexibility, all of which lead to some minimized hazard of re-harm.
